How they compare
New Caledonia currently reports 2.28 terawatt-hours against 2.23 terawatt-hours in Bahamas, a difference of 0.05 terawatt-hours.
The two have swapped places 1 time across 25 shared years of data; in 2000 it was Bahamas ahead.
Bahamas ranks 116th and New Caledonia ranks 115th of 214 countries.
Across the 3 decades both report, Bahamas averaged higher in 1 and New Caledonia in 2.
Head to head by decade
| Decade | Bahamas | New Caledonia | Difference | Ahead |
|---|---|---|---|---|
| 2000s | 2.02 terawatt-hours | 1.42 terawatt-hours | 0.599 terawatt-hours | Bahamas |
| 2010s | 1.97 terawatt-hours | 2.42 terawatt-hours | 0.449 terawatt-hours | New Caledonia |
| 2020s | 2.1 terawatt-hours | 2.37 terawatt-hours | 0.266 terawatt-hours | New Caledonia |
Averages of every year both report within each decade.
